SpryPoint

SpryPoint

SpryPoint provides cutting-edge cloud-based solutions for utilities, enhancing customer service and operational efficiency in North America.

Electric Utilities
51-250
Founded 2011

Description

  • Provide direction, guidance, and mentorship to a team of software engineers.
  • Foster a collaborative, innovative environment that supports knowledge sharing and professional growth.
  • Conduct regular one-on-one meetings and performance evaluations, and provide constructive feedback.
  • Collaborate with Product Owners to define and prioritize user stories and backlog items.
  • Serve as the Agile advocate and coach, and facilitate Agile ceremonies including stand-ups, grooming, sprint planning, sprint reviews, and retrospectives.
  • Monitor team progress, remove obstacles, and support successful sprint delivery.
  • Work cross-functionally with Product, User Experience Design, Customer Success, Sales, and Service Delivery teams.
  • Support clients and incidents with the Customer Success team, lead support developers, and participate in the rotating on-call schedule.
  • Plan, prioritize, and allocate tasks to ensure efficient use of resources and timely delivery.
  • Provide technical guidance on architecture decisions, code reviews, problem-solving, and software quality standards.
  • Identify skill gaps and create opportunities for training, learning, and development within the team.

Requirements

  • Bachelor’s degree in Computer Science, Engineering, or a related field.
  • 5+ years of software development experience, with a focus on Java backend web applications.
  • Previous experience in a leadership or mentorship role.
  • Proficiency in Java and related frameworks.
  • Strong understanding of backend development concepts such as RESTful APIs, microservices architecture, and asynchronous processing.
  • Experience with relational databases and SQL.
  • Experience with web technologies including HTML, JavaScript, and CSS.
  • Familiarity with cloud platforms and services such as AWS, Azure, or Google Cloud Platform.
  • Hands-on experience with Git, CI/CD pipelines, and automated testing frameworks.
  • Strong software design, object-oriented programming, and clean code practices; ability to write maintainable, testable code.
  • Excellent problem-solving and communication skills in a fast-paced Agile environment.
  • Interest in expanding knowledge and applying it to solve industry problems.
  • Experience balancing scalability, performance, and security considerations.
  • Background in cross-functional collaboration is preferred.

Benefits

  • Remote-first environment with flexible working hours across North America.
  • Comprehensive compensation package that grows with you.
  • MacBook plus $800 to set up your home workspace.
  • Health, dental, vision, and life insurance from day one.
  • Generous PTO and unlimited sick days.
  • RRSP matching in Canada and 401(k) matching in the U.S.
  • $2,500 annual development fund, tuition assistance, and Book Bounty program.
  • Annual company events and team offsites.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er (AI-Enabled) - Brazil

Codurance 51-250 Internet Software & Services

Codurance is hiring a senior Software Craftsperson to work with client teams building maintainable software and improving engineering practices, including responsible AI-enabled ways of working.

AWS CI/CD Java TypeScript
55 minutes ago

Software Engineer, Flight Software (Starship)

SpaceX 10K-50K Aerospace & Defense

SpaceX is hiring a Software Engineer for Starship Flight Software to help design, develop, test, and integrate software that controls and simulates flight systems for its fully reusable launch vehicle program.

C++ Rust
1 hour, 25 minutes ago

Staff Software Engineer

Alphasense 51-250 Industrial Conglomerates

AlphaSense is hiring a Staff Software Engineer to support its Expert Research mission by building and improving the systems, workflows, and user experiences behind expert call services and related product capabilities.

Agile GraphQL Machine Learning Microservices React Ruby on Rails TypeScript Vue.js
2 hours, 56 minutes ago

Senior Software Engineer- Linux/eBPF

Datadog 5K-10K IT Services

Datadog’s eBPF Platform team is hiring a software engineer to build and evolve the Datadog Agent’s shared eBPF infrastructure and GPU Monitoring foundation across Linux kernels and GPU workloads.

C Linux
3 hours, 37 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ers